#!/usr/bin/env node
const fs = require('fs');
const path = require('path');
const { Resvg } = require('@resvg/resvg-js');
// Use collections from src/collections.js
const { collections } = require('../src/collections.js');
// Accept collection as a CLI arg or env var
const collectionArg = process.argv.find(arg => arg.startsWith('--collection='));
const collectionName = collectionArg ? collectionArg.split('=')[1] : (process.env.COLLECTION || 'logos');
const collection = collections.find(c => c.name === collectionName) || collections[0];
const imagesDir = path.join(__dirname, '..', 'public', collection.baseDir);
const outputFile = path.join(__dirname, '..', 'public', collection.dataFile);
const imagesVarDir = path.join(__dirname, '..', 'public', collection.varDir);
// Remove old PNG/JPG folders if they exist
const pngDir = path.join(__dirname, '..', 'public', collection.baseDir + '-png');
const jpgDir = path.join(__dirname, '..', 'public', collection.baseDir + '-jpg');
if (fs.existsSync(pngDir)) fs.rmSync(pngDir, { recursive: true, force: true });
if (fs.existsSync(jpgDir)) fs.rmSync(jpgDir, { recursive: true, force: true });
// Get file extension without the dot
function getFileExtension(filename) {
return path.extname(filename).slice(1).toUpperCase();
}
// Get file name without extension
function getBaseName(filename) {
return path.basename(filename, path.extname(filename));
}
// Convert filename to readable name (replace hyphens with spaces, capitalize words)
function formatName(filename) {
return getBaseName(filename)
.split(/[-_]/)
.map(word => word.charAt(0).toUpperCase() + word.slice(1).toLowerCase())
.join(' ');
}
// Clean directory (remove all contents)
function cleanDir(dir) {
if (fs.existsSync(dir)) {
for (const file of fs.readdirSync(dir)) {
if (file !== '.gitignore') {
const filePath = path.join(dir, file);
if (fs.lstatSync(filePath).isDirectory()) {
fs.rmSync(filePath, { recursive: true, force: true });
} else {
fs.unlinkSync(filePath);
}
}
}
} else {
fs.mkdirSync(dir, { recursive: true });
}
}
// Convert SVG to PNG with transparency
function svgToPng(svgBuffer, width, height) {
// No background specified to maintain transparency
const resvg = new Resvg(svgBuffer, {
fitTo: { mode: 'width', value: width || 256 }
});
const pngData = resvg.render().asPng();
return pngData;
}
// Convert SVG to JPG
function svgToJpg(svgBuffer, width, height) {
// For JPGs we need a white background since JPG doesn't support transparency
const resvg = new Resvg(svgBuffer, {
background: 'white',
fitTo: { mode: 'width', value: width || 256 }
});
const pngData = resvg.render().asPng();
return pngData;
}
// Pregenerate PNG and JPG images for SVG files
function pregenerateImages(logoFiles, imagesDir, imagesVarDir) {
cleanDir(imagesVarDir);
// Only process SVG files
const svgFiles = logoFiles.filter(file => /\.svg$/i.test(file));
for (const file of svgFiles) {
const base = getBaseName(file);
const svgPath = path.join(imagesDir, file);
const pngPath = path.join(imagesVarDir, base + '.png');
const jpgPath = path.join(imagesVarDir, base + '.jpg');
try {
const svgBuffer = fs.readFileSync(svgPath);
const pngBuffer = svgToPng(svgBuffer, 256, 256);
fs.writeFileSync(pngPath, pngBuffer);
const jpgBuffer = svgToJpg(svgBuffer);
fs.writeFileSync(jpgPath, jpgBuffer);
} catch (e) {
console.error('Error generating PNG/JPG for', file, e);
}
}
}
